[0034] see Figure 1 to Figure 4 As shown, this embodiment provides a guide sliding assembly, which is used to be arranged between the first part 111 and the second part 112 which slide relatively. The first part 111 is provided with an arc-shaped groove, and the second part 112 can The length direction of the arc-shaped groove reciprocates. The guide slide assembly includes a base 101. The base 101 is used to be fixedly connected with the second part 112. The base 101 has an arc surface suitable for the arc-shaped groove. A ball 105, the ball 105 is used to contact the inner surface of the arc groove.
[0035] Based on this structure, the guide slide assembly provided in this embodiment can be installed in a component with an arc-shaped groove. When in use, the base 101 is fixedly connected to the second part 112. [0058] see Figure 5 As shown, this embodiment provides a telescopic boom, including the first boom section 109, the second boom section 110 and the guide slide assembly provided in Embodiment 1 of the present invention, the first boom section 109 is sleeved on the second boom section 110 , an arc-shaped groove is provided on the inner surface of the first arm section 109 , the second arm section 110 can reciprocate along the length direction of the arc-shaped groove, and the base 101 is fixedly connected to the outer surface of the second arm section 110 .
[0059] In the telescopic jib provided in this embodiment, the inner surface of the first arm section 109 is provided with arc-shaped grooves. Using the guide slide assembly provided in Embodiment 1 of the present invention can form rolling friction between curved surfaces, improving the performance of arc-shaped grooves.
